Hello,

I'm thinking of creating a recirculating mash system based off a bunch of different design here. What I was hoping to accomplish was the ability for 10G batches eventually.

The problem with 10G batch is the 120V electric heaters for boiling water. Would it be possible to design one with the HLT run off electric and the BK run off gas for the 10G boil?

Are there any considerations I am missing with a system like this? Thoughts?
 
I've currently got my BK on Nat Gas, my RIMS is electric and the HLT is gas. At some point I'd like to go all electric but the combo works fine.
